Mortgage Law in California

In Del Mar, California, a mortgage is a loan given to purchase a certain piece of property - usually a house - with the property being purchased with the loan serving as collateral for that same loan.

Taking out a mortgage and buying a house is not a decision to make lightly. Nonetheless, mortgages serve some very useful purposes. Because houses are so expensive, it's impossible for most people to buy them by paying the whole price upfront. A mortgage ensures that the seller gets paid immediately, and that the buyer is able to pay the purchase price over a long period of time, in manageable installments.

Buying something with a loan costs more than just the purchase price. This is because lenders charge interest on their loans, which, when all is said and done, adds up to a very massive amount of money.

Many people find this arrangement to be mutually beneficial - the lender makes a profit, and the borrower is able to buy a home where it would otherwise have been impractical.

Getting a Mortgage in Del Mar, California

When attempting to get a mortgage in Del Mar, California, it's essential to have a long track record of good credit. In lending such a large amount of money, banks take a significant risk. However, if you mitigate that risk somewhat with proof that you always pay your debts, you are a far less risky prospect, as far as the bank is concerned, making them far more likely to approve a loan.

The majority of lenders require a down payment on any mortgage. This is normally represented as some percentage of the total purchase price. Lenders require this to show that the borrower is financially solvent, indicating that they are typically responsible with their money. You should ensure that you have more money than the required down payment saved up, so that making this payment doesn't hurt your financial situation.

It's also necessary to be realistic about your financial situation when calculating monthly payments. Obviously, a more expensive house will result in higher mortgage payments. While buying a house on credit may tempt you to get something more expensive than you can really afford, you should resist this temptation. Having a big, expensive home won't count for much if you can't make the payments, and it gets foreclosed. You should make a reasonable accounting of the expenses associated with home ownership. This includes mortgage payments, property taxes, and others.

Once this is in order, it will be time to finish the credit agreement. When this happens, there is no going back. Therefore, make sure you are perfectly clear about each and every term of the mortgage agreement, knowing your rights and obligations.

Life in Del Mar

Del Mar is located in San Diego County, California. With a smaller population of about 4,500, Del Mar is an upscale city known for its beautiful beaches and legendary surfing. The name "Del Mar" means "by the sea" or "of the sea", as it is located directly on the Pacific Coast. The city was mentioned in the Beach Boys hit song, "Surfin' USA".

Del Mar is home to several beaches which are known as excellent surfing spots. In particular, 15th Street Beach in Del Mar was listed as #4 on Time Magazine's list of "100 Greatest Beaches in the World". Other beach sites include Torrey Pines State Beach and North Beach, affectionately known as "Dog Beach" by the many dog owners who frequent the area.

Del Mar, California is also famous for being the home to the annual San Diego County Fair. The fair is one of the most popular summer fairs in all of California and is held at the Del Mar Fairgrounds. The Fairgrounds also houses the Del Mar Racetrack.
